My skin has always been normal or fairly dry but lately just my forehead area has been oily. And it's only when I wake up in the morning, and have just washed my face the night before. I normally switch between 3 different facial cleansers and use a toner and oil free moisturizer.
Any tips or advice on how to prevent this?

I just use a cleanser free of hydroxy acids, and also detergents because the more oil you remove from your skin, the more your skin produces. Use and effective but gentle cleanser ( Clinique or Cetaphil works great for me) and any water based cleanser. I always start with warm water to open pores while cleansing, and then I use cool water to close. Also, try not to dry your face off before applying moisturizer, as moisturizer really only serves to lock in moisture, not as much to add it in. : )
